What had to exist
An operator needed one finance screen for three things: the state of the import, overdue alerts, and the four numbers checked during operations. The design problem was hierarchy: status, exceptions, and operating figures each needed a clear place on one screen without shouting over each other.
The dashboard puts all three in a dark interface. Import status, an alert banner, and the key metrics share the same view.

The import-health decision
Import health sits as an operating status on the dashboard itself, right beside the finance figures. If the import is broken, the numbers under it can't be trusted, so hiding the status on a settings page somewhere was never an option. The operator sees the health of the data and the data in the same glance.
The alert decision
Overdue items get an alert treatment: a banner that creates a separate level for anything needing attention, inside the same screen.
The hierarchy is the feature. Alert above, status alongside, metrics below. Each type of information keeps its own role, and nothing gets to bury the thing that needs action today.
The four-number decision
The main metric band holds four operating numbers:
- Net
- Items needing review
- Cash across accounts
- Outstanding invoices
Four. Not fourteen. The band is limited to the numbers the operator actually checks, which is what makes them readable as one group instead of a wall of tiles nobody looks at.
